Como faço para correr como Sudo Raiz em Fedora

Como faço para correr como Sudo Raiz em Fedora
Um usuário raiz tem todo o acesso administrativo em um sistema operacional Linux. Alguns dos privilégios raiz incluem a remoção de um arquivo, adicionar/remover uma conta de usuário, instalar/remover um aplicativo, alterar as permissões de arquivo, etc. Um usuário padrão não possui esse tipo de privilégio. No entanto, um administrador pode conceder aos privilégios de sudo do usuário padrão para executar comandos administrativos. Dessa forma, um usuário padrão (usuário sem raiz) pode executar comandos administrativos sem fazer login como usuário root. Os comandos então correm como se esse usuário fosse um administrador.

Esta posta. Ele cobrirá o processo passo a passo sobre como adicionar um usuário, definir uma senha para ele e depois atribuir privilégios sudo. No final, verificaremos se o usuário recebeu os privilégios do sudo e pode executar os comandos como sudo.

1. Faça login como um usuário root usando o comando abaixo:

$ su -

Digite a senha do usuário root.

2. Execute o comando abaixo para adicionar um novo usuário:

$ adduser

3. Defina uma nova senha para este usuário usando o comando abaixo:

$ passwd

4. Em Linux, o /etc/sudoers Arquivo define quais usuários podem usar o comando sudo e quais comandos eles têm permissão para executar. Você pode editar este arquivo usando o comando abaixo:

$ visudo

No arquivo, procure a linha que diz:

%roda tudo = (tudo) tudo

Esta linha concede a todos os membros da roda do grupo para executar todos os comandos como sudo. Verifique se a linha acima não é comentada (não possui um símbolo # no início). Se a linha for comentada, remova o símbolo # e, em seguida, salve e saia do editor.

5. Agora, para conceder qualquer privilégio do usuário sudo, adicione -o ao grupo de rodas usando o comando abaixo:

$ userMod -AG Wheel

Por exemplo, para conceder aos privilégios do Sudo "Umara" do usuário, precisaremos adicioná -lo ao grupo "roda" usando o comando abaixo:

$ userMod -AG Wheel Umara

6. Para verificar se o usuário foi adicionado ao grupo "roda", execute o comando abaixo:

$ id

Você deve ver o grupo "roda" na saída do comando acima.

7. Agora, para verificar se o usuário tem o acesso do sudo, mude para esse usuário usando o comando abaixo:

$ su -

Depois de executar este comando, você verá que o prompt foi alterado para o novo usuário. Agora tente executar qualquer comando como sudo como Sudo LS, Atualização Sudo DNF, etc. Ele pedirá a senha do sudo. Digite a senha da conta de usuário, não a conta raiz. Agora, o comando será executado e você verá a saída.

Se você receber uma mensagem como “não está no arquivo sudoers. Este incidente será relatado ”, significa que o procedimento não foi feito corretamente e o usuário não tem privilégios sudo. Certifique -se de estar conectado como raiz e seguiu todas as etapas corretamente.

O comando sudo permite que os usuários executem comandos administrativos sem precisar da senha raiz. Neste post, compartilhamos como você pode executar comandos como Sudo Root em Fedora. Lembre -se, você também pode restringir quais comandos um usuário pode ser executado como root. Portanto, se alguns usuários não exigirem acesso total à raiz, eles podem ter acesso apenas às tarefas de que precisam para realizar.